**Mgmt Meeting Minutes — Retiring the Brightline Range**

Quick recap for sales leads at Fenholt Supplies: we agreed to retire the Brightline fixture range by year-end. Remaining stock moves to clearance pricing next month, and accounts on standing orders get migrated to the Lumetta range. Trade-in incentives were approved in principle. The confidential note on next steps sits just below.

board note of bajof-bajeg: The pricing group signed off on a budget of $13.4 million for Project Sildor. The renewal with Lamixek Holdings closes at $48.9 million a year, 49 percent above the last contract.

Ticket QRX-412: Nightly search reindex failing on the Lanternfish staging cluster. Plugin authors reported their custom analyzers silently skipped since Tuesday. Root cause: env file on the reindex host was regenerated without the indexer credentials, so the job fell back to read-only mode and logged nothing useful. Fix: restore the full env block from the Coveport vault export. Plugin authors, no action needed on your side once this lands — your analyzers will pick up automatically. The missing indexer credential belongs on the next line.

sealed setting: VAULT_KEY5=54f99

Changed defaults, on-call folks, so read this one. The loyalty-points ledger now batches accrual writes every 500ms instead of per-transaction, which cuts write load roughly 60% but means balances can lag by up to a second. Alerts tuned accordingly — don't panic at small transient mismatches between the ledger and the rewards cache; they self-heal. Reversals still apply synchronously. If a batch flush fails three times, the service halts accruals and pages you. The new defaults ship as the following configuration values.

settings of hagug-fawip:
BRIWYN_LOG_LEVEL=warn
BRIWYN_METRICS_HOST=metrics.briwyn.qorvelsys.internal
BRIWYN_POOL_SIZE=8